EnteroMedics, Inc.
EnteroMedics, Inc. Medical SpecialtiesHealth Technology EnteroMedics, Inc. is a medical device company, which in the design, and development of devices that use neuroblocking technology to treat obesity,metabolic diseases, and other gastrointestinal disorders. It offers vBlock system, which is a therapy to limit expansion of hte stomach, help control hunger sensations between meals, reduce the frequency and intensity of stomach contractions and produce a feeling of early and prolonged fullness. The company was founded by Mark B. Knudson, Robert S. Nickoloff, Timothy R. Conrad, Katherine S. Tweden and Richard R. Wilson on December 19, 2002 and is headquartered in St. Paul, MN.

Vividion Therapeutics, Inc.
Vividion Therapeutics, Inc. Miscellaneous Commercial ServicesCommercial Services Vividion Therapeutics, Inc. operates as a biotechnology company. The company focuses on developing innovative therapeutics that treat major unmet clinical needs using the first platform for proteome wide drug and target discovery. It's proprietary chemoproteomic platform technology addresses the key limitations of conventional screening techniques and allows the discovery of previously unknown, or cryptic, functional pockets on the surface of proteins and identification of small molecules that selectively bind to those targets. The company was founded by Benjamin F. Cravatt, Phil S. Baran, Jin-Quan Yu and John K. Clarke on December 24, 2013 and is headquartered in San Diego, CA. | Miscellaneous Commercial Services | Director/Board Member | |

Painscript Corp.
Painscript Corp. Internet Software/ServicesTechnology Services Part of Optimus Healthcare Services, Inc., Painscript Corp. is a medical treatment compliance platform that focuses on creating personalized pathways to support chronic care management interventions for patients suffering from opioid and other substance use disorders. The company is based in Rockville, MD. The platform is technology-based and clinically validated through nine separate published and peer-reviewed clinical trials. Painscript's approach is accessible and user-friendly via a digital platform, providing physicians and patients with daily, evidence-based telehealth monitoring interventions designed to improve patient compliance with treatment protocols, leading to better health outcomes and a reduction in related healthcare costs. Daniel L. Cohen has been the CEO of the company since 2019. Painscript was acquired by Optimus Healthcare Services, Inc. on March 24, 2021 for $4.50 million. | Internet Software/Services | Chief Executive Officer | |
